Pełny tekst źródłaA SCARA-robot that draws requires a high level of precision and accuracy. This project aims to build a three degree of freedom robot arm that uses inverse kinematics, to draw a picture that has been assigned to it. The project explores the robot’s accuracy as well as its speed. Several measurements were conducted during the project to assess the Robot Arm’s reliability. When the robot makes points in the same position several times, it achieves near-perfect precision, but it has trouble recreating the proper geometrics of the picture being drawn. It may be caused by a variety of factors, it is most likely caused by a play in the timing belt. When the robot performs a circular movement, the problem arises when one of the arms switches its direction. In this paper, the robot’s construction and programming are described.

Pełny tekst źródłaThis work is an use-wear analysis of the upper sequence of Grotte Mandrin in Mediterranean France (from the 55th to 43rd millennium). In this sequence, the Neronian level of Grotte Mandrin appears as an anomaly, both from a technical and a functional perspective. Its profusion of points and their not only microlithic but also standardized character prompts reflection on the purpose of these productions. What is the meaning of this signature, combining standardization and real microlithization within a single unit of this vast archaeological sequence? Through a functional study specifically oriented toward research, determination and understanding of the associations of impact scars, a method of approach, an impact study, is presented here, and constructed from a systematic, original experiment. An impactological study of the Mandrin E points reveals that at least 15.5% of them were used as weapons. In the absence of any other criteria revealing other functions, and in view of the exceptionally high rate of impacted pieces, we must consider whether all of these small objects belong directly and exclusively to the sphere of armaments. The extreme reduction of these micro- and nanopoints results in a particularly weak inert weight that can only be compensated for by a propulsion system with very high kinetic energy. Attention has therefore been focused on the mode of propulsion used to make these very small, sometimes less than a centimeter, points effective and efficient. The results lead to the conclusion that only a propulsion system such as the bow would be able to offset the low kinetic energy of all of these small impacted elements discovered at Mandrin E

Pełny tekst źródłaHese deficits coexist in the acute phase of a depressive episode and interfere with decision-making and goal-directed behaviors, and the associated feeling of effort. They appear to persist in periods of clinical remission, decreasing the quality of the therapeutic and functional response and lately worsening the prognosis of the disorder. The aim of this work is to identify objectively measurable neurocognitive markers in clinical practice, and to study their association with the prognosis of a depressive episode, in order to better predict remission and potentially to optimize therapeutic prescribing strategies for patients accordingly. The impairment of neurocognitive processes related to reward constitutes a first vulnerability marker for major depressive disorder (MDD): in a study assessing the production of motor effort in order to obtain a reward, depressed patients had a deficit in production of effort, unlike healthy subjects. Such deficit in incentive motivation - a process underpinned by the activation of ventral cortico-striatal circuits in healthy subjects - may constitute a specific dimension of MDD. It participates in the decision-making and action processes impairments and is associated with – and possibly a consequence of- more specifically cognitive deficits. In a study assessing several cognitive functions in a large cohort of depressed patients, the persistence of psychomotor retardation after 6 to 8 weeks of treatment - in patients considered as being in clinical remission - was positively and independently correlated with the number of past depressive episodes, thus constituting a marker of "cumulative" marker of past depressive episodes. Finally, in a literature review on the progressive evolution of cognitive deficits in MDD, we discussed the existence of a “neurotoxic” effect of the lifetime accumulation of depressive episodes on neurocognitive deficits and its consequences on disease prognosis (increased risk of incomplete functional/clinical remission, relapses, evolution towards dementia). One of the main interest in identifying clinical and cognitive markers of vulnerability is to highlight their capacity to predict the course of a depressive episode-or disorder. In a study based on a cohort of more than 500 depressed patients, a measurement of attention (d2 attention test) was able to significantly and independently predict the subsequent course towards complete remission (clinical and functional) and to constitute a trait -marker of depression, easy to use in clinical practice. Other cognitive markers (such as executive functions) have shown high predictive values for therapeutic response, comparable to those provided by imaging or electrophysiology markers, according to the results of a recent meta-analysis, that emphasizes the interest of using them in patient’s follow-up. Finally, in order to better assess the prognosis of depressive disorder, we have shown that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D) diagnosis criteria - which nevertheless represents a specific depressive disorder with well-known physiopathology substrates (construction validity) - had a low predictive validity, prompting to consider this disorder as a temporary expression of a mood disorder, rather than a specific disorder. The identification of clinical tools measuring motivational and cognitive deficits in clinical routine and predicting the course of a depressive episode or disorder represents a major challenge in the improvement of personalized therapeutic management and the long-term prognosis in depressed patients

The thesis develops a four axis SCARA robot arm using Delta servo motors and pressure control element. The SCARA robot arm uses PLC-based control system to realize high stability and high precious, and uses vision processing technology to identify color and shape of the objects. In the robot structure, we use the Delta ASDA-MS system as the control core. The ASDA-MS system controls the AC servomotors through the driving devices. The motion trajectories of Delta servo motors are programmed, through the Programmable Logic Controller and motion planning agency itself. The first and second axis are horizontal rotation by two Delta servomotor drivers. Then install the ball screw spline in the second axis of the robot arm through Delta servomotor drivers. And reach Z-axis rotation and linear motion mode. The gripper is driven by a pressure control element, and catches the assigned object. The robot arm can finish the control functions of point-to-point control and continuous path control. Users can program these functions of the robot arm on the user interface. In the experiment results, the SCARA robot arm can reach positioning accuracy and handling test. The thesis finished various functions according to "PMC Robot Competition", such as “positioning accuracy”, “repeatability longitude”, “cycle time”, “goods handling tasks” and “image recognition”.

In the modern community, various robot arms are widely used in different industrial areas. In general, the engineer manually set target point and pathway via the computer in advanced so that the robot arm can strictly move along with the preset path. If there exists a problem of visiting multiple targets, the preset path cannot be ensured that is the best arrangement. In order to improve the production efficiency, the moving cost of the robot arm needs to be reduced to carry out our study purpose. In this paper, we will present an experiment of locking screws to clearly introduce our proposed algorithm. Each point needs to be passed only once for the overall experimental procedure. Obviously, this is a typical travelling salesman problem (TSP). To be honest, the previous algorithms can only solve some problems in 2D space. However, this study is applied to cope with the issue of optimal path of locking screws in 3D space by the Selective Compliance Assembly Robot Arm (SCARA). The heights of screw holes are different when the detected object is 3D structure. Then, it is observed that the path between two points may be obstructed by certain obstacles to seriously disturb the normal work of a robot arm. In order to solve this problem, Kinect is used to build the 3D model of the object and simultaneously detect screw holes based on the image processing method. To avoid the robot arm hitting the obstacle on the path, we have to utilize avoiding algorithm to stop this situation appearance. The avoiding algorithm based on the visibility graph algorithm has been proposed in this study in order to let the general visibility graph algorithm transfer to 3D space. Namely, we propose a strategy to add new nodes so that it can help us easily calculate the moving cost of each point. Substituting the moving cost into TSP to calculate the optimal path where the TSP problem can be solved by the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) and 2-Opt algorithms. Finally, transferring the image coordinate to SCARA coordinate to let the robot arm complete the whole task.
